About Mercari
Mercari, Inc (OTCMKTS:MCARY) is a Japan-based e-commerce company that operates a peer-to-peer marketplace platform, enabling individuals to list, buy and sell used and new items via its mobile application and website. The platform accommodates a wide range of categories, including fashion, electronics, home goods and collectibles, and integrates payment processing and shipping coordination to streamline transactions for users.
Founded in February 2013 by Shintaro Yamada, Mercari quickly gained traction in its domestic market and went public on the Tokyo Stock Exchange in June 2018.
